Subject: Re: [PATCH v5 17/20] ACPI: platform_profile: Check all profile handler to calculate next
Date: Thu, 7 Nov 2024 16:05:05 -0600 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<cbdc6ff5-627e-4237-a053-bbf2e77499da@amd.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<989e7297-97f9-4d55-be28-78128572fed2@gmx.de>
On 11/7/2024 02:58, Armin Wolf wrote:
> Am 07.11.24 um 07:02 schrieb Mario Limonciello:
>
>> As multiple platform profile handlers might not all support the same
>> profile, cycling to the next profile could have a different result
>> depending on what handler are registered.
>>
>> Check what is active and supported by all handlers to decide what
>> to do.
>>
>> Tested-by: Mark Pearson <mpearson-lenovo@squebb.ca>
>> Signed-off-by: Mario Limonciello <mario.limonciello@amd.com>
>> ---
>> v5:
>> * Adjust mutex use
>> ---
>> drivers/acpi/platform_profile.c | 23 ++++++++++++++---------
>> 1 file changed, 14 insertions(+), 9 deletions(-)
>>
>> diff --git a/drivers/acpi/platform_profile.c b/drivers/acpi/
>> platform_profile.c
>> index 7f302ac4d3779..2c466f2d16b42 100644
>> --- a/drivers/acpi/platform_profile.c
>> +++ b/drivers/acpi/platform_profile.c
>> @@ -411,34 +411,39 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(platform_profile_notify);
>>
>> int platform_profile_cycle(void)
>> {
>> + enum platform_profile_option next = P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ST;
>> enum platform_profile_option profile;
>> - enum platform_profile_option next;
>> + unsigned long choices;
>> int err;
>>
>> if (!class_is_registered(&platform_profile_class))
>> return -ENODEV;
>>
>> scoped_cond_guard(mutex_intr, return -ERESTARTSYS, &profile_lock) {
>> - if (!cur_profile)
>> - return -ENODEV;
>> + err = class_for_each_device(&platform_profile_class, NULL,
>> + &profile, _aggregate_profiles);
>> + if (err)
>> + return err;
>>
>> - err = cur_profile->profile_get(cur_profile, &profile);
>> + err = class_for_each_device(&platform_profile_class, NULL,
>> + &choices, _aggregate_choices);
>> if (err)
>> return err;
>>
>> - next = find_next_bit_wrap(cur_profile->choices,
>> P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ST,
>> + next = find_next_bit_wrap(&choices,
>> + P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ST,
>> profile + 1);
>
> Could it be that this would lead to be "custom" profile being selected
> under some conditions?
Yeah, you're right. If all drivers supported custom then this could
happen. I'll clear custom like this:
choices &= ~BIT(PLATFORM_PROFILE_CUSTOM);
> Also _aggregate_profiles() expects profile to be initialized with
> P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ST.
Will correct initialization in platform_profile_cycle() to this.
enum platform_profile_option profile = P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ST;
But this also raises a good point. If _aggregate_profiles() returns
custom then this should be an error because next profile is undefined.
So I'll catch that like this.
err = class_for_each_device()
if (err)
return err;
if (profile == PLATFORM_PROFILE_CUSTOM)
return -EINVAL;
>
> Thanks,
> Armin Wolf
>
>>
>> - if (WARN_ON(next == PLATFORM_PROFILE_LAST))
>> - return -EINVAL;
>> + err = class_for_each_device(&platform_profile_class, NULL,
>> &next,
>> + _store_class_profile);
>>
>> - err = cur_profile->profile_set(cur_profile, next);
>> if (err)
>> return err;
>> }
>>
>> sysfs_notify(acpi_kobj, NULL, "platform_profile");
>> - return 0;
>> +
>> + return err;
>> }
>> E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(platform_profile_cycle);
>>
